Fertilizer sacks have a three- number value called the NPK value written on them. What does the NPK stand for (18-24-12 written
MrMuchimi

Answer:

it's. a level number

Explanation:

Every label carries three conspicuous numbers, usually right above or below the product name. These three numbers form what is called the fertilizer's N-P-K ratio — the proportion of three plant nutrients in order: nitrogen (N), phosphorus (P) and potassium (K).
